Description

Circuit board maintenance work platform
Technical Field
The utility model relates to a circuit board maintenance work platform technical field especially relates to a circuit board maintenance work platform.
Background
The types of the circuit boards are various, when the circuit boards need to be maintained, the circuit boards need to be placed on a professional maintenance platform and maintained by professional personnel, and in the circuit board maintenance process, processes such as soldering tin and wiping are needed.
Present circuit board maintenance work platform, when maintaining the circuit board, need relapse the two sides of manual switching circuit board, inconvenient maintenance personal's maintenance work, and in the maintenance process, if when soldering tin to the circuit board, the toxic gas that produces during its soldering tin fails to obtain the filtration, maintenance personal's is healthy can't be guaranteed, in addition, produce during soldering tin the tin sediment and leave over easily on the circuit board, need clear away through the manual work, it is inconvenient to use, we have designed a circuit board maintenance work platform for this reason.

Detailed Description
The technical solutions in the embodiments of the present invention will be described clearly and completely with reference to the accompanying drawings in the embodiments of the present invention, and it is obvious that the described embodiments are only some embodiments of the present invention, not all embodiments.
Referring to fig. 1-4, a circuit board maintenance workbench comprises a maintenance platform 1, wherein an n-type support frame 2 is fixed on the top of the maintenance platform 1, a back plate 3 is fixed on the rear end face of the n-type support frame 2, the back plate 3 is fixedly arranged on the top of the maintenance platform 1, support foot frames 4 are fixed on the periphery of the bottom of the maintenance platform 1, a bearing plate 5 is fixed between the four support foot frames 4, a material receiving box 6 is installed on the top of the bearing plate 5, a rotating groove is formed in the maintenance platform 1, rotating columns are rotatably connected to two sides of the inner wall of the rotating groove, a square frame 7 is fixed between the two rotating columns, two universal shafts 8 fixed on the inner top wall of the n-type support frame 2 are arranged above the square frame 7, a dust hood 9 and an LED illuminating lamp 10 are respectively fixed on the other ends of the two universal flexible shafts 8, a corrugated pipe 11 is fixed on the top of, the top of n type support frame 2 is fixed with suction fan 13, the air inlet department of suction fan 13 is connected with return bend 14, the other end of return bend 14 links to each other with the other end of straight tube 12, straight tube 12 imbeds on n type support frame 2, the air outlet department of suction fan 13 is connected with the outlet duct, the other end of outlet duct is connected with dust collection box 15, dust collection box 15 is fixed at the top of n type support frame 2, be connected with upset clearance mechanism 17 between mouth style of calligraphy frame 7 and the maintenance platform 1, install clamping mechanism 18 on the mouth style of calligraphy frame 7, setting through two universal flexible axle 8, conveniently adjust the position of dust cage 9 and LED light 10, high durability and convenient use, the setting of LED light 10, can conveniently throw light on when maintaining the maintenance personnel.
Furthermore, the positioning columns are fixed on the periphery of the bottom of the material receiving box 6, the positioning holes matched with the positioning columns are formed in the top of the bearing plate 5, and the material receiving box 6 is arranged under the rotating groove, so that the dropped tin slag can be conveniently collected.
Further, the inner wall of dust collection box 15 is fixed with filter screen 16, and a plurality of ventholes have been seted up to the one end that deviates from the outlet duct on the dust collection box 15, and filter screen 16's setting can filter the toxic gas that produces when soldering tin to discharge through the venthole, effectively guaranteed that the environment in workshop is not polluted by toxic gas, ensured that maintenance personal's is healthy.
Further, the overturning cleaning mechanism 17 comprises an n-shaped movable frame 1701 slidably connected to the top of the square frame 7, a cleaning brush is fixed on the inner top wall of the n-shaped movable frame 1701, two symmetrical sliding blocks 1702 are fixed at the bottom of the n-shaped movable frame 1701, a sliding groove matched with the sliding blocks 1702 is formed in the top of the square frame 7, a screw 1703 is connected to the inner wall of one sliding block 1702 in a threaded manner, two ends of the screw 1703 are respectively and rotatably connected to two sides of the inner wall of the sliding groove, one end of the screw 1703 extends to the outer side of the square frame 7 and is fixed with a gear 1704, when the square frame 7 overturns in the rotating groove, the gear 1704 is engaged with the arc-shaped rack 1705 during overturning of the square frame 7, the gear 1704 can be rotated, the screw 1703 is rotated, and the n-shaped movable frame 1701 is further moved on the top of the square frame 7, thus, the cleaning brush on the n-type movable frame 1701 removes the solder dross remaining when soldering the main surface of the circuit board.
Further, the outside meshing of gear 1704 is connected with arc rack 1705, arc rack 1705 is fixed on the inner wall of rotation groove, one end of one of them rotation post extends to the rear end face of maintenance platform 1 to be fixed with gear 1706, the meshing of the below of gear 1706 is connected with sharp rack 1707, sharp rack 1707 sliding connection is at the rear end face of maintenance platform 1, the rear end face of maintenance platform 1 is fixed with electric telescopic handle 1708, electric telescopic handle 1708's control end links to each other with one end of sharp rack 1707, electric telescopic handle 1708's model is YNT-01.
Further, clamping mechanism 18 includes two L type splint 1801 of sliding connection on mouthful style of calligraphy frame 7 inner wall, two L type splint 1801 one side dorsad mutually all articulates there are two movable rods 1802, the other end of two movable rods 1802 with one side all articulates there is removal seat 1803, the inner wall of mouthful style of calligraphy frame 7 is seted up and is removed seat 1803 matched with shifting chute, the inner wall in shifting chute is fixed with slide bar 1804, it establishes the spring 1805 in the slide bar 1804 outside to be equipped with the cover between the one end of removal seat 1803 and the tip in shifting chute, all be fixed with the protection pad on the one side inner wall that two L type splint 1801 subtend mutually, the perpendicular cross-section of L type splint 1801 and protection pad is L type column structure respectively, the setting of protection pad, when avoiding pressing from both sides tight the circuit board, cause the double-layered phenomenon.
The working principle is as follows: when an operator needs to maintain a circuit board, the circuit board is firstly placed between two L-shaped clamp plates 1801, the circuit boards with different sizes can be clamped and fixed under the matching of a movable rod 1802, a movable seat 1803, a slide rod 1804 and a spring 1805, and workers can conveniently maintain the circuit board, under the action of a suction fan 13 and a dust hood 9, toxic gas generated in the soldering tin maintenance of the circuit board can be sucked out, the toxic gas enters the inside of a dust collection box 15 of the dust collection box, the gas is further filtered under the action of a filter screen 16 and is discharged through an air outlet hole, the pollution of the toxic gas generated in the soldering tin maintenance of peripheral air is avoided, the health of the maintenance workers is effectively ensured, the positions of the dust hood 9 and the LED illuminating lamp 10 are conveniently adjusted through the arrangement of two universal flexible shafts 8, the use is convenient, when the workers need to maintain the back of the circuit board, under the condition that the circuit board is not disassembled, the electric telescopic rod 1708 can be started, the linear rack 1707 is pushed, the linear rack 1707 transmits the second gear 1706, the square frame 7 overturns in the rotating groove, and when the square frame 7 overturns, the first gear 1704 can rotate and rotate the first gear 1704 due to meshing with the arc rack 1705, so that the n-shaped movable frame 1701 moves at the top of the square frame 7, the residual tin slag generated when the cleaning brush on the n-shaped movable frame 1701 cleans the main surface of the circuit board during soldering tin, the tin slag falls into the material receiving box 6, manual recycling is facilitated, and the working principle of the device is completed.
